The followup to 2009's Dead Samurai, The Dishwasher: Vampire Smile is a combo-fueled, fast-paced, stylistic 2D action platformer that features the series' staple gritty, graphic novel-inspired art style, built on a new engine that allows for an even more visually gruesome experience.

Pros
- Fast and satisfying combat
- Unique art style and atmosphere
- Great soundtrack
- Multiple characters and weapons
- Local and online co-op
Cons
- Short story and game length
- Some visual effects may cause eyestrain
- Online co-op can be glitchy
- Repetitive enemy patterns
- No port of first game on pc
